What's The Definition Of Resistless?
[adj] offering no resistance; "resistless hostages"; "No other colony showed such supine, selfish helplessness in allowing her own border citizens to be mercilessly harried"- Theodore Roosevelt
[adj] impossible to resist; overpowering; "irresistible (or resistless) impulses"; "what happens when an irresistible force meets an immovable object?" Synonyms | Synonyms for Resistless: inactive | irresistible | overpowering | overwhelming | passive | supine | unresisting Related Terms | Find terms related to Resistless: See Also | Resistless In Webster's Dictionary \Re*sist"less\, a.
1. Having no power to resist; making no opposition. [Obs. or
R.] --Spenser.
2. Incapable of being resisted; irresistible.
Masters' commands come with a power resistless To
such as owe them absolute subjection. --Milton.
-- {Re*sist"less*ly}, adv. -- {Re*sist"less*ness}, n.
